Definitions:

Hobbes's Ideas

The political philosophies of Thomas Hobbes, which emphasize the necessity of a strong central authority to avoid the chaos and conflict inherent in the state of nature.

Benjamin Franklin

A Founding Father of the United States known for his contributions as a statesman, author, publisher, scientist, inventor, and diplomat.

Eugenics Movement

A social and scientific movement that aimed at improving the genetic quality of the human population through selective breeding and sterilization, based on theories of heredity.

Social Darwinism

The application of Darwin's theory of natural selection to social, political, and economic issues, often used to justify political conservatism, imperialism, and racism.
